Output 21266070a7c7a8e9375c6898e5e96194b9a2fd7ecf5b95cf398264bfc340c00f:3

value
5994647
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b945494286fefdb0fffe0cf690ab06500355f23 OP_EQUALVERIFY OP_CHECKSIG
address
17tdNZfUHjkPnsorsQNRRgAfV9cVqC33yo
transaction
21266070a7c7a8e9375c6898e5e96194b9a2fd7ecf5b95cf398264bfc340c00f
spent
true